Best cop movies of the 80's


I'll give you my three picks right at the top:

To Live and Die in LA (1985)Directed by William Friedkin
starring William Petersen

Year of the Dragon (1985) Directed by Michael Cimino
starring Mickey Rourke

Manhunter (1986) Directed by Michael Mann
starring William Petersen


What others can you name?
